Amidst the pain of mark-to-market investment losses, the (re)insurance industry has been hoping that higher interest rates unleashed in the past year were a sign of changing times and future earnings benefits to come.

After all, if you look back to before the 2008 financial crisis, the past decade is what looks like an aberration, in which a massive chunk of potential income for the industry evaporated due to ultra-low interest rates.
